About The Role:
As a Property Management Associate at CBRE, you will play a key role in supporting the management of a diverse range of commercial, industrial, or retail properties. You will assist in various aspects such as marketing, operations, and financial activities, all while adhering to management agreements and company policies.
This position falls within the Property Management function, where you'll take charge of ensuring excellent service delivery for our clients.
What You'll Do:
- Respond promptly to tenant needs, ensuring administrative and technical staff address issues effectively and vendor services are contracted when necessary.
- Conduct regular property inspections and make recommendations regarding maintenance and alterations as needed.
- Manage accurate payment processes for vendor invoices and prepare tenant billings.
- Market the property, showcase available space to potential tenants, and coordinate tenant move-ins and move-outs.
- Serve as the primary contact for property owners, ensuring objectives are met and preparing timely, comprehensive reports.
- Develop and control annual budgets for operating and capital expenses, providing detailed forecasts and performance analyses.
- Collect rent, manage expenses in compliance with lease terms, and oversee tenant delinquencies, including legal notifications.

What You'll Need:
To excel in this role, you'll need to meet the following qualifications:
- Bachelor's Degree preferred with 2-5 years of relevant experience; a combination of education and experience will also be considered.
- Real Estate license if mandated by state regulations.
- Ability to understand and apply existing procedures to solve complex problems.
- Strong analytical skills to evaluate solutions using your technical expertise.
- Profound kn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ite (including Word, Excel, Outlook).
- Excellent organizational skills with a proactive approach to tasks.

Compensation Details:
The salary range for the Property Management Associate position is $90,000 - $100,000, with offers dependent on the candidate's skills, qualifications, and experience.
Benefits:
Full-time employees enjoy a comprehensive benefits package, including medical, dental, vision, 401(k) plan, paid time off, parental leave, and holidays.
